What the 310 V/µs slew rate buys you

The -3 dB bandwidth of 290 MHz covers the small-signal range; the slew rate determines how fast the output can track a large step. For a 5 V peak-to-peak output, 310 V/µs translates to roughly a 16 ns rise time, which keeps the signal clean for video-rate or fast-settling applications.

The supply span runs from 9 V minimum to 32 V maximum, so this part works on ±5 V, ±12 V, ±15 V split rails, or a single 12 V or 24 V industrial bus without a secondary regulator. Quiescent current is 7.8 mA — not a low-power part, but reasonable for the speed. If your BOM is power-constrained, the 7.8 mA is the standing draw per channel; the load current adds on top.
